Baked Glazed Virginia Ham Recipe
Description
This delightful Baked Glazed Virginia Ham, perfect for gatherings and festive occasions, offers a harmonious blend of smoky and sweet flavors. The glaze, featuring mango chutney and Dijon mustard, creates a rich, caramelized exterior that enhances the tender, juicy meat. Ideal for serving a crowd, this dish is sure to impress.

Ingredients
| Quantity | Ingredient | 
|---|---|
| 1 | Smoked ham | 
| 6 cloves | Garlic | 
| 8 1/2 oz | Mango chutney | 
| 1/2 cup | Dijon mustard | 
| 1 cup | Light brown sugar | 
| 1 | Orange (zested and juiced) | 
Instructions
- Preheat the Oven: Start by preheating your oven to 350°F (175°C) to ensure it’s at the perfect temperature for baking.
- Prepare the Ham: Place the smoked ham in a heavy roasting pan, ensuring it sits securely for even cooking.
- Make the Glaze: In a food processor, mince the garlic using the steel blade. Then, add the mango chutney, Dijon mustard, light brown sugar, orange zest, and orange juice. Process the mixture until it achieves a smooth consistency.
- Glaze the Ham: Pour the prepared glaze generously over the ham, ensuring it’s well coated for that delectable caramelized finish.
- Bake: Transfer the ham to the oven and bake for 1 hour, or until it is fully heated through and the glaze has developed a beautifully browned exterior.
- Serve: Once done, remove the ham from the oven and let it rest for a few minutes. Serve hot or at room temperature for a delightful addition to any meal.
